Ayaneo unveils Konkr Pocket Advance, a modern tribute to the Game Boy Advance
Ayaneo unveils the Konkr Pocket Advance, a retro-inspired handheld with modern features, but pricing and release details remain unknown.
More than 25 years after the Game Boy Advance debuted in the United States, Ayaneo has introduced a modern handheld inspired by Nintendo’s iconic console. During its latest product showcase, the company revealed the Konkr Pocket Advance. This new gaming device combines the familiar design of the original Game Boy Advance with updated hardware and modern connectivity features.

The announcement comes only weeks after the 25th anniversary of the Game Boy Advance’s US launch. While Nintendo has not announced a successor to its classic handheld, Ayaneo aims to appeal to retro gaming enthusiasts with a device that closely resembles the original while offering features expected of today’s portable gaming systems.
A familiar design with modern upgrades
The Konkr Pocket Advance retains the horizontal layout that made the original Game Boy Advance instantly recognisable. However, the new handheld replaces the older display technology with a 3.5-inch LCD panel featuring a resolution of 960 x 640 pixels. Although the screen is sharper than the original, it preserves the same 3:2 aspect ratio to maintain the classic gaming experience.
Ayaneo has also expanded the control layout beyond the original design. Alongside the standard ABXY buttons, the handheld includes dedicated menu controls and additional shoulder buttons, providing greater compatibility with modern games and emulators. These additions allow the device to support a wider range of gaming experiences while keeping the familiar look of Nintendo’s classic console.
The company has also equipped the handheld with several contemporary features. The Konkr Pocket Advance includes a USB-C port for charging and data transfer, a microSD card slot for expandable storage, and built-in Wi-Fi and Bluetooth connectivity. It also retains a 3.5 mm headphone jack and a physical volume adjustment wheel, details that reinforce its retro-inspired design while improving everyday usability.
Colour choices celebrate the original handheld
Ayaneo has introduced the Konkr Pocket Advance in two colour options that pay tribute to well-known Game Boy Advance editions. One version features a navy blue finish that closely resembles the classic Indigo model. At the same time, the second comes in a coral-orange shade inspired by the popular Spice Orange variant released in select markets.
The colour choices reflect the company’s intention to recreate the appearance and feel of the early 2000s handheld while delivering updated hardware. By blending nostalgic styling with current technology, Ayaneo is targeting players who grew up with the original system as well as younger audiences interested in retro gaming.
The overall design remains faithful to the proportions and appearance of the original console. Still, the inclusion of modern ports and wireless capabilities positions the Konkr Pocket Advance as a practical handheld for contemporary gaming. The combination of classic aesthetics and updated specifications continues a growing trend among manufacturers producing retro-inspired gaming devices.
Release details remain unknown
Despite unveiling the hardware, Ayaneo has not confirmed when the Konkr Pocket Advance will become available or how much it will cost. The absence of pricing and launch information means prospective buyers will have to wait for further announcements before making purchasing decisions.
The company has previously released several niche handheld gaming devices, many of which have been produced in relatively small quantities. One recent example was the Pocket Micro 2, which sold out within minutes because of its limited production run. That experience has led to speculation that the Konkr Pocket Advance could also face high demand if initial stock levels are restricted.
Many enthusiasts are hoping Ayaneo will manufacture the new handheld in greater numbers to avoid the shortages seen with earlier releases. A larger production run would allow more retro gaming fans to purchase the device without competing for limited stock shortly after launch.
For now, the Konkr Pocket Advance stands as Ayaneo’s latest attempt to combine nostalgia with modern hardware. While questions remain over its price and availability, its updated display, expanded controls and contemporary connectivity features suggest it could become an attractive option for players looking to revisit the Game Boy Advance experience on modern hardware.
